Contact Information
Melrose Self Storage
3717 W Lake St, Melrose Park, IL, 60160
(708) 345-0620
Category: Moving and Storage Services
Website: N/A
Email: N/A
Map & Directions
Directions
What is your departure address?
Hours of Operation
Opening hours not available. Please contact Melrose Self Storage at 708-345-0620.
Reviews & Discussion
Citations
20 visits to Melrose Self Storage Melrose Park on Lake St